Is La Liga Available on JioTV?

So, the burning question: Can you directly watch La Liga on JioTV? The answer is a bit nuanced. JioTV is primarily a platform that aggregates various TV channels and some streaming content. Whether you can watch La Liga on JioTV depends on whether JioTV has a partnership with the official broadcaster of La Liga in India.

As of now, La Liga broadcasting rights in India are held by Viacom18. This means that the matches are primarily streamed on JioCinema, which is Viacom18's streaming platform. While JioTV offers access to many TV channels, it doesn't directly stream La Liga matches unless they have an agreement with Viacom18 to showcase JioCinema's content.

Alternative Ways to Watch La Liga in India

If you can't find La Liga directly on JioTV, don't worry! There are several other reliable ways to catch the action. Here are some of the best alternatives:

1. JioCinema

Since Viacom18 holds the broadcasting rights for La Liga, JioCinema is your go-to platform. JioCinema provides live streaming of all La Liga matches, along with highlights, replays, and other related content. This is generally the most reliable way to ensure you don't miss any of the games.

2. Sports18 Channels

Viacom18 also broadcasts La Liga matches on their Sports18 channels. If you have a TV subscription that includes these channels, you can watch the matches on your television. Check your TV guide to see the schedule of La Liga broadcasts.

  • Available Channels:
    • Sports18 1
    • Sports18 Khel

3. Sony LIV

In previous years, Sony Pictures Networks held the rights to La Liga, and matches were broadcast on Sony LIV. While Viacom18 currently holds the rights, it's worth checking Sony LIV to see if they have any streaming options available, as broadcasting agreements can sometimes change.
